Deep Dive Into Business Administration or Accounting Degree Options

A business administration or accounting degree serves as the cornerstone for numerous professional opportunities in the modern business world. When evaluating whether to pursue a business administration degree or an accounting degree, it's essential to understand the core distinctions between these programs. A bachelor's in business administration provides extensive education across multiple business disciplines, including management, marketing, finance, human resources, and organizational leadership. In contrast, a bachelor's in accounting focuses specifically on tax preparation and auditing practices. The accounting degree requirements typically emphasize professional expertise in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P), financial statement analysis, tax law, and audit procedures. Meanwhile, a business admin degree cultivates managerial skills across diverse functional areas, making graduates versatile professionals capable of managing teams across various industries and organizational contexts.

The methodologies employed in degree curricula at accredited institutions differ significantly based on program focus. Business administration degree programs integrate practical business scenarios to develop critical thinking and decision-making abilities across multiple domains. Students pursuing a business administration or accounting degree engage with financial software platforms that professionals use daily. Accounting degree programs emphasize rigorous problem-solving through tax preparation, audit projects, and financial analysis assignments. Both professional tracks require strong analytical skills, but accounting professionals need advanced proficiency in tax codes and audit standards. Business administration professionals, conversely, benefit more from cross-functional understanding enabling them to transition between departments and industries throughout their careers.
